What Are Working Capital Loans?

Working capital loans supply the cash your Albany business needs to manage day-to-day operations without liquidating assets or missing payroll. Unlike equipment financing or commercial real estate loans tied to specific purchases, these funds flow directly into your operating account to bridge revenue gaps, stock inventory ahead of peak seasons, or cover unexpected repairs. Most working capital products carry repayment terms from three months to eighteen months, with daily or weekly payment structures that align with your cash cycle. Who Qualifies for Business Working Capital Loans in Albany?

Lenders typically require six months of operating history, a minimum monthly revenue threshold, and a credit score above 600, though requirements vary by product and lender. How quickly can I receive working capital funds in Albany?+
After you submit bank statements and basic documentation, most working capital lenders fund within five to ten business days. Emergency advances can arrive faster if you qualify for expedited underwriting and already maintain business accounts at a participating institution.
What costs should I expect with a working capital loan?+
Expect an origination fee, often one to five percent of the advance, plus interest or a factor rate applied to the total. We show you the true cost, total repayment divided by amount borrowed, so you can compare offers transparently before choosing a lender.
Can I use working capital to pay off existing debt?+
Yes, many Albany businesses consolidate higher-cost merchant cash advances or credit-card balances into a single working capital term loan with a clearer repayment schedule. We help structure the payoff to improve cash flow and reduce daily or weekly payment pressure.
Do I need collateral for a business capital loan?+
Many working capital products rely on a personal guarantee and a blanket lien on business assets rather than specific collateral like real estate or titled equipment. Some lenders accept accounts receivable or inventory as security, which can lower the cost and extend terms.
How does working capital differ from a business line of credit?+
A term working capital loan disburses a lump sum you repay on a fixed schedule, while a business line of credit lets you draw and repay repeatedly up to a limit. Lines suit ongoing, unpredictable needs; term loans work better for one-time gaps or planned expenses.
Will applying hurt my credit score?+
Initial pre-qualification uses a soft inquiry that does not affect your score. Once you choose a lender and move to formal underwriting, a hard pull appears on your credit report, but shopping multiple offers within a short window typically counts as a single inquiry.
